After I posted my contrast nmm gold tutorial recently I had a few people asking for a steel tutorial using the same contrast technique.<br />
So, being the nice guy that I am here it is! 馃檪<br />
<br />
Here are the stages I used-<br />
<br />
1. Undercoat grey seer spray.<br />
<br />
2. Place initial light reflections with space wolves grey. (Try not to make these too regular)<br />
<br />
3. Inside the first stage reflections I used gryph charger grey to darken the area.<br />
<br />
4. I repeated the process with basilicanum grey.<br />
<br />
5. Black templar was then used as a final shade in the darkest areas of the blade.<br />
<br />
6. I then used grey seer base paint as a thin glaze to soften the gradient between stages.<br />
<br />
7. I wasn't happy with the blend at this point so I tried out apothecary white as a glaze to smooth the transitions and it worked great.<br />
<br />
8. Pure white was then used as a thin glaze inside the lightest reflections on the blade.<br />
<br />
9. Then I used pure white as a sharp line highlight to define the blade and add hot spot reflections and I also went back with a little black Templar to deepen some shading.<br />
You could finish at this stage if you wish but the next stage shows what more can be added.<br />
<br />
10. With the blade complete I wanted to add some colour to it. Steel and silver reflect their environment so it's nice to keep that in mind.<br />
I decided to add some gold reflections to the bottom of the blade with nazdreg yellow (imagine it's next to a gold leg). I also added some blue reflections with Aethematic blue to give it a daytime feel.<br />
This stage isn't usually done much with nmm gold do it's fun to do with steel as it can set the scene for your miniature.<br />

I wanted to see how easy and fast it would be to achieve a decent skin tone as its always a part of a mini that can cause problems.<br />
<br />
Here are the stages I used-<br />
<br />
1. Over an undercoat of wraithbone spray I applied a 50/50 mix of darkoath flesh and contrast medium.<br />
<br />
2. I then shaded in select areas with pure darkoath flesh.<br />
<br />
3. I repeated this process with fyreslayer flesh focusing more on the deeper recesses.<br />
<br />
4. Then with pure cygor brown I picked out the deepest areas such as the eyes, mouth and ears.<br />
<br />
5. The entire face then got a glaze of 50/50 mix skeleton horde and contrast medium.<br />
<br />
6. I then washed around the nose, lip and cheeks with an equal parts mix of flesh tearers red, fyreslayer flesh and contrast medium.<br />
At this point I also washed a small amount of space wolves grey around the eyes.<br />
<br />
7. I then highlighted the face with wraithbone base paint. I did this in about 3 thin layers.<br />
<br />
8. Pure white was then used to pick out the very edge and define the face.<br />
<br />
9. I used a little basilicanum grey to define the eyes before painting them and finishing the hair.<br />
<br />
There you go! As with the nmm tutorial I did this technique is faster than regular painting and I think it gave a good result.<br />
This way of painting skin isn't that different to what I'd normally do but it takes the hassle out of trying to lay down a smooth basecoat.<br />

With the release of the new Citadel contrast paints I thought it would be a great opportunity to re visit painting non metallic metals (nmm).<br />
I wanted to try out the new contrast colours and apply them to this technique to see what results I could achieve.<br />
With this in mind I picked a suitable miniature which was a Stormcast Liberator and undercoated it with the new wraithbone spray.<br />
All contrast paints where thinned with the new contrast medium during this process.<br />
Here are the stages I did when painting-<br />
<br />
1. Wraithbone spray<br />
2. Nazdreg yellow<br />
3. Snakebite leather<br />
4. Fyreslayer flesh<br />
5. Cygor brown<br />
6. Black templar<br />
7. Iyanden yellow glaze all over<br />
8. Wraithbone base paint highlight<br />
9. Pure white highlight<br />
<br />
You can see that most of the technique involves a lot of glazing the colours over each other. Rather than highlighting in stages as you would normally paint this involves working backwards essentially. So starting with larger areas of lighter colours and then shading down with less paint.<br />
As with all nmm painting the real trick is when you add those final white highlights and hot spots to trick the eye.<br />
I鈥檓 pretty happy with the test result and compared to my other nmm painting it was much quicker although a little messier if I鈥檓 honest but I鈥檓 sure with more practice with the paints this will improve.<br />

I thought I'd share with you my current 40k Space Marine army project.<br />
With the release of 8th edition 40k and the new Primaris marines I thought it was a great opportunity to build a new army and learn the new system.<br />
The Dark Imperium box came with a force of marines that I intended to build onto to bulk out my army.<br />
I then had to make the all important decision as to what chapter I would do my new army. Knowing that I wanted to get something on the table top quickly I decided on a metallic colour scheme as these are fast to produce and are very forgiving when it comes to shading and highlighting.<br />
I then had a look at the available chapters in steel armour and settled on the Silver Skulls chapter.<br />
I remember the Silver Skulls from the original Rogue trader 40k book and knew they had a solid background so they where an easy choice.<br />
The chapter symbol is the old Iron Warrior icon from the old Chaos space marine transfer sheet, luckily I had plenty of these to use.<br />
The main armour for the marines is simply a black undercoat then leadbelcher spray then wash nuln oil and black ink mix. This allowed me to get the main part of each marine painted quickly so I could focus on the helmets and other details.<br />

Hi all, I started this miniature a while ago now and I'm pretty sure that it wont get finished. I did do a stage by stage on the skin (yes it's blue) so i thought I'd post it up anyway.<br />
Hopefully someone might find it useful!<br />
Cheers! Daz<br />
<br />
1. Undercoat grey<br />
2. Basecoat Hawk Turquoise + Bleached bone mix 80/20<br />
3. Shade Thunderhawk Blue<br />
4. Highlight Hawk Turquoise + Kommando Khaki 70/30<br />
5. Add Bleached Bone into the previous mix to highlight<br />
6. Add White to the previous mix to highlight<br />
7. Shade Incubi Darkness<br />
8. Add blue and red tones around ears and mouth<br />
9. Mix black into the highlight mix and paint under the eyes<br />
10. Paint Bleached bone in the bottom shadows<br />
11. Paint Kommando Khaki in the bottom shadows<br />
12. Highlight Bleached Bone<br />
13. Highlight WhiteDarren Lathamhttp://www.blogger.com/profile/09642994396991179585noreply@blogger.com0tag:blogger.com,1999:blog-2897924708984145679.post-56902309968805144082017-04-23T11:27:00.000-07:002017-04-23T11:27:44.617-07:00Goblin WarbossHi all,<br />

I get asked a lot about painting non metallic metals, also
known as NMM. In this post I hope to explain the theory behind the technique
and also how I go about rendering this technique on a miniature.</div>
<div class="MsoNormal">
<br /></div>
<div class="MsoNormal">
To start with it's worth saying that the non metallic metal
technique is basically a way of painting convincing metal effects on to a 2D
surface. You will see this used on a lot of art when the artist has to paint
metallic areas without the aid of metallic paints. This Blood Angel art by Dave
Gallagher is a good example of this.</div>
<div class="separator" style="clear: both; text-align: center;">
<a href="https://blogger.googleusercontent.com/img/b/R29vZ2xl/AVvXsEjer10Qml8qJFoJB_s20IHARwZiiM7FiNv4auHDZqsaYZs7zqCxOldZST5ZHjdKcEEf5BiP9KF8GiN3gna6T2r6yZdbGsdloxfJzFmIUwWkQspARcdRNECAu5P_A5kr1qudWOF8ELT4rBw/s1600/ba_01.jpg" imageanchor="1" style="margin-left: 1em; margin-right: 1em;"><img border="0" src="https://blogger.googleusercontent.com/img/b/R29vZ2xl/AVvXsEjer10Qml8qJFoJB_s20IHARwZiiM7FiNv4auHDZqsaYZs7zqCxOldZST5ZHjdKcEEf5BiP9KF8GiN3gna6T2r6yZdbGsdloxfJzFmIUwWkQspARcdRNECAu5P_A5kr1qudWOF8ELT4rBw/s1600/ba_01.jpg" /></a></div>
<div class="MsoNormal">
<br /></div>
<div class="MsoNormal">
<br /></div>
<div class="MsoNormal">
So with this in mind technically NMM should not really be
applied to miniature painting as it is a 2D technique and miniature painting is
a 3D art form. This certainly doesn't stop miniature painters from applying non
metallic metals to miniatures because if done well it can create a pleasing
finish.</div>
<div class="MsoNormal">
Painting NMM is all about tricking the viewer into thinking
that what they are seeing is real metals, to do this you need to observe how
light reflects and reacts to different metallic surfaces. A great way to start
to lean this is to look at art work. You can pretty much transfer what the
artist has done onto your miniature, when I started learning NMM I painted a
few sword blades and copied what I saw on the art onto the blade. My Death
master Snikch is a good example.</div>
<div class="separator" style="clear: both; text-align: center;">
<a href="https://blogger.googleusercontent.com/img/b/R29vZ2xl/AVvXsEgMXXESfhLTuC9CGsEzhHGLt1bkPq8cvp1eEZ4lQDDPlLUxXZbJhVyFVCGdKUdnO5fN9auR8mo2Y1KpuFFZoEHz0uKQfAIJDoOOSHg7sZDxn6pOCwdh8KsQAxeqAj8R7M0utyD1SKFbPDc/s1600/DL_DeathmasterSnitch.jpg" imageanchor="1" style="margin-left: 1em; margin-right: 1em;"><img border="0" height="547" src="https://blogger.googleusercontent.com/img/b/R29vZ2xl/AVvXsEgMXXESfhLTuC9CGsEzhHGLt1bkPq8cvp1eEZ4lQDDPlLUxXZbJhVyFVCGdKUdnO5fN9auR8mo2Y1KpuFFZoEHz0uKQfAIJDoOOSHg7sZDxn6pOCwdh8KsQAxeqAj8R7M0utyD1SKFbPDc/s640/DL_DeathmasterSnitch.jpg" width="640" /></a></div>
<div class="MsoNormal">
<br /></div>
<div class="MsoNormal">
<br /></div>
<div class="MsoNormal">
When I approach painting a miniature in non metallics I
first imaging 4 points of light around the top of the model. This help me to
place my initial guide highlights over the model. I've found that imagining
these four spots of light at each corner of the miniature gives me a good
indication of where the light will be as I paint the model, it's easy to get
confused and a bit lost when painting NMM so this keeps it simple for me. The
amazing diagram below should help :).</div>
<div class="separator" style="clear: both; text-align: center;">
<a href="https://blogger.googleusercontent.com/img/b/R29vZ2xl/AVvXsEgk075DKQ4_5HGXNddhkmEoBLSLSgcWxA0frbTUQxA_GnHYd7bGgUjOafGBUlUBWtVvlcpR70lAFrqBjrUXhxsC9kVDhK3mOUNwNPPcWOeLFp8m7mQBMr9lu1sU9KUY-drCPSY7h3tVzCE/s1600/Image004.jpg" imageanchor="1" style="margin-left: 1em; margin-right: 1em;"><img border="0" height="379" src="https://blogger.googleusercontent.com/img/b/R29vZ2xl/AVvXsEgk075DKQ4_5HGXNddhkmEoBLSLSgcWxA0frbTUQxA_GnHYd7bGgUjOafGBUlUBWtVvlcpR70lAFrqBjrUXhxsC9kVDhK3mOUNwNPPcWOeLFp8m7mQBMr9lu1sU9KUY-drCPSY7h3tVzCE/s400/Image004.jpg" width="400" /></a></div>
<div class="MsoNormal">
<br /></div>
<div class="MsoNormal">
<br /></div>
<div class="MsoNormal">
Another trick when painting NMM is to change the tone of the
colour when the surface you are painting changes angles. So if you are painting
some gold armour and it has a corner change the tone from extreme light to
extreme dark at this point. You can see in the image below how much the
contrast changes in the armour surface as it changes shape, the foot is a good
example of the colour going from light to dark to light again giving the illusion
of a reflective surface.</div>
<div class="separator" style="clear: both; text-align: center;">
<a href="https://blogger.googleusercontent.com/img/b/R29vZ2xl/AVvXsEjA3KT4FE-XRMFk6BJMTvKOQsqwJl4tNwVY4KE-sUwWqcwb0SbhzM2sjLab9KuV8ajhB7tWwQTFrWLDqbWNLseiJ1UTlvsjmRlsYv-fBxHYRKLCU6HplkoI7WqOeq_vmcAPkhQbo50CU44/s1600/20150823_121409+-+Copy.jpg" imageanchor="1" style="margin-left: 1em; margin-right: 1em;"><img border="0" height="640" src="https://blogger.googleusercontent.com/img/b/R29vZ2xl/AVvXsEjA3KT4FE-XRMFk6BJMTvKOQsqwJl4tNwVY4KE-sUwWqcwb0SbhzM2sjLab9KuV8ajhB7tWwQTFrWLDqbWNLseiJ1UTlvsjmRlsYv-fBxHYRKLCU6HplkoI7WqOeq_vmcAPkhQbo50CU44/s640/20150823_121409+-+Copy.jpg" width="276" /></a></div>
<div class="MsoNormal">
<br /></div>
<div class="MsoNormal">
<br /></div>
<div class="MsoNormal">
What I've found helps a lot in achieving a realistic shiny
metallic finish is a the last stage of reflection highlights that are added.
When trying to learn this technique I observed that many painters didn't add
this effect to their NMM and I started to experiment with it. The stages below
on the Sanguinor which I painted show how this last stage can really give you
that shiny reflective effect to the surface. Adding these reflection lines and
hot spots over the surface in the correct places and on the edges can give you
a nice effect.</div>

Here are the paints that I use when painting non metallic
metals-</div>
<div class="MsoNormal">
<br /></div>
<div class="MsoNormal">
<u>Gold NMM<o:p></o:p></u></div>
<div class="MsoListParagraphCxSpFirst" style="margin-left: 37.5pt; mso-add-space: auto; mso-list: l0 level1 lfo1; text-indent: -18.0pt;">
<!--[if !supportLists]--><span style="font-family: "symbol"; mso-bidi-font-family: Symbol; mso-fareast-font-family: Symbol;">路<span style="font-family: "times new roman"; font-size: 7pt; font-stretch: normal;">
</span></span><!--[endif]-->Basecoat Snakebite leather (Balor Brown)</div>
<div class="MsoListParagraphCxSpMiddle" style="margin-left: 37.5pt; mso-add-space: auto; mso-list: l0 level1 lfo1; text-indent: -18.0pt;">
<!--[if !supportLists]--><span style="font-family: "symbol"; mso-bidi-font-family: Symbol; mso-fareast-font-family: Symbol;">路<span style="font-family: "times new roman"; font-size: 7pt; font-stretch: normal;">
</span></span><!--[endif]-->Highlight by mixing in Bubonic brown (Zamesi
Desert)</div>
<div class="MsoListParagraphCxSpMiddle" style="margin-left: 37.5pt; mso-add-space: auto; mso-list: l0 level1 lfo1; text-indent: -18.0pt;">
<!--[if !supportLists]--><span style="font-family: "symbol"; mso-bidi-font-family: Symbol; mso-fareast-font-family: Symbol;">路<span style="font-family: "times new roman"; font-size: 7pt; font-stretch: normal;">
</span></span><!--[endif]-->Highlight by mixing in Bleached bone (Ushabti
Bone)</div>
<div class="MsoListParagraphCxSpMiddle" style="margin-left: 37.5pt; mso-add-space: auto; mso-list: l0 level1 lfo1; text-indent: -18.0pt;">
<!--[if !supportLists]--><span style="font-family: "symbol"; mso-bidi-font-family: Symbol; mso-fareast-font-family: Symbol;">路<span style="font-family: "times new roman"; font-size: 7pt; font-stretch: normal;">
</span></span><!--[endif]-->Shade with Terracotta (Doombull Brown)</div>
<div class="MsoListParagraphCxSpMiddle" style="margin-left: 37.5pt; mso-add-space: auto; mso-list: l0 level1 lfo1; text-indent: -18.0pt;">
<!--[if !supportLists]--><span style="font-family: "symbol"; mso-bidi-font-family: Symbol; mso-fareast-font-family: Symbol;">路<span style="font-family: "times new roman"; font-size: 7pt; font-stretch: normal;">
</span></span><!--[endif]-->Shade with Terracotta and Black mix</div>
<div class="MsoListParagraphCxSpMiddle" style="margin-left: 37.5pt; mso-add-space: auto; mso-list: l0 level1 lfo1; text-indent: -18.0pt;">
<!--[if !supportLists]--><span style="font-family: "symbol"; mso-bidi-font-family: Symbol; mso-fareast-font-family: Symbol;">路<span style="font-family: "times new roman"; font-size: 7pt; font-stretch: normal;">
</span></span><!--[endif]-->Highlight with Bleached bone and white mix</div>
<div class="MsoListParagraphCxSpMiddle" style="margin-left: 37.5pt; mso-add-space: auto; mso-list: l0 level1 lfo1; text-indent: -18.0pt;">
<!--[if !supportLists]--><span style="font-family: "symbol"; mso-bidi-font-family: Symbol; mso-fareast-font-family: Symbol;">路<span style="font-family: "times new roman"; font-size: 7pt; font-stretch: normal;">
</span></span><!--[endif]-->Glaze the area with Lhamian medium and yellow
ink mix</div>
<div class="MsoListParagraphCxSpMiddle" style="margin-left: 37.5pt; mso-add-space: auto; mso-list: l0 level1 lfo1; text-indent: -18.0pt;">
<!--[if !supportLists]--><span style="font-family: "symbol"; mso-bidi-font-family: Symbol; mso-fareast-font-family: Symbol;">路<span style="font-family: "times new roman"; font-size: 7pt; font-stretch: normal;">
</span></span><!--[endif]-->Glaze into the recesses with Lhamian medium and
red ink mix</div>
<div class="MsoListParagraphCxSpLast" style="margin-left: 37.5pt; mso-add-space: auto; mso-list: l0 level1 lfo1; text-indent: -18.0pt;">
<!--[if !supportLists]--><span style="font-family: "symbol"; mso-bidi-font-family: Symbol; mso-fareast-font-family: Symbol;">路<span style="font-family: "times new roman"; font-size: 7pt; font-stretch: normal;">
</span></span><!--[endif]-->Pick out the reflection points with pure white<br />
<div class="separator" style="clear: both; text-align: center;">
<a href="https://blogger.googleusercontent.com/img/b/R29vZ2xl/AVvXsEhWZu4oJEHl-95xGWLU5f5CMvO6uU4mXQxcIqrC47ptBbZQp5YGUYj1oY6cjd47R3eI_gZneDa5y1_ORPUU-H1pyOZM6l01yGSxK9PKBtKdaRqdS03C-josDnbw53fnlnuEJM3D5J37UeU/s1600/20181201_202400.jpg" imageanchor="1" style="margin-left: 1em; margin-right: 1em;"><img border="0" data-original-height="800" data-original-width="640" src="https://blogger.googleusercontent.com/img/b/R29vZ2xl/AVvXsEhWZu4oJEHl-95xGWLU5f5CMvO6uU4mXQxcIqrC47ptBbZQp5YGUYj1oY6cjd47R3eI_gZneDa5y1_ORPUU-H1pyOZM6l01yGSxK9PKBtKdaRqdS03C-josDnbw53fnlnuEJM3D5J37UeU/s1600/20181201_202400.jpg" /></a></div>
<br /></div>
<div class="MsoListParagraphCxSpLast" style="margin-left: 37.5pt; mso-add-space: auto; mso-list: l0 level1 lfo1; text-indent: -18.0pt;">
<br /></div>
<div class="MsoNormal" style="margin-left: 1.5pt;">
The stage that you add the glazes
is quite important as until this stage they are can appear very wooden and
lacking in colour. The glazes add a lot of richness to the surface and punch a
lot of colour in for you. Doing it at the end of the highlight and shade process
gives you a lot of control over the desired finish.</div>
<div class="MsoNormal" style="margin-left: 1.5pt;">
<br /></div>
<div class="MsoNormal" style="margin-left: 1.5pt;">
For NMM silver I tend to change
the colours I use depending on the miniature. shades of grey, black and white
will do you for pretty much any of this and once again you can add the colour
you like with glazes of blues, browns at the end stages</div>
<div class="MsoNormal" style="margin-left: 1.5pt;">
<br /></div>
<div class="MsoNormal" style="margin-left: 1.5pt;">
The image of Ikit Claw is a good
example of a few different NMM colours on one model, I wanted to give him copper armour with steel
claws and brass detailing. It was all painted using the same technique but by
changing the colours I used.</div>
<div class="separator" style="clear: both; text-align: center;">
<a href="https://blogger.googleusercontent.com/img/b/R29vZ2xl/AVvXsEjXr9tD71-IdtA4uce1h1IilBSC775D2JAyzJxV1mgmi89JWPntucxMCKwZQOvaQemnYNqFEe1YQLFImtUVZUzq5GBowSdFlPlArhL6wDdZW30YBXCwKjaCzMnyLHfn_WQh_YRFKv041JM/s1600/100_1651.JPG" imageanchor="1" style="margin-left: 1em; margin-right: 1em;"><img border="0" src="https://blogger.googleusercontent.com/img/b/R29vZ2xl/AVvXsEjXr9tD71-IdtA4uce1h1IilBSC775D2JAyzJxV1mgmi89JWPntucxMCKwZQOvaQemnYNqFEe1YQLFImtUVZUzq5GBowSdFlPlArhL6wDdZW30YBXCwKjaCzMnyLHfn_WQh_YRFKv041JM/s1600/100_1651.JPG" /></a></div>
<div class="MsoNormal" style="margin-left: 1.5pt;">
<br /></div>
<div class="MsoNormal" style="margin-left: 1.5pt;">
<br /></div>
<div class="MsoNormal" style="margin-left: 1.5pt;">
The image of the Dwarf Lord shows
the steel NMM technique next to the gold one. Notice the white hot spot
highlights placed within the extreme dark areas.</div>
<div class="separator" style="clear: both; text-align: center;">
<a href="https://blogger.googleusercontent.com/img/b/R29vZ2xl/AVvXsEj5QvyW-xiQRiV0_nSkcOCO_u5Pz-ZJhxUuJl95nmYNyDmfS6OHH5WPOJ_ueO-aFhPl9W9EX1VzRSNJCq8LMqIQmkbJBcj43ckk3R2CHMFh7QanuRv232qVU9QVdhC_hzmxjfPlKp4jcUY/s1600/20140815_185409+%25282%2529.jpg" imageanchor="1" style="margin-left: 1em; margin-right: 1em;"><img border="0" height="640" src="https://blogger.googleusercontent.com/img/b/R29vZ2xl/AVvXsEj5QvyW-xiQRiV0_nSkcOCO_u5Pz-ZJhxUuJl95nmYNyDmfS6OHH5WPOJ_ueO-aFhPl9W9EX1VzRSNJCq8LMqIQmkbJBcj43ckk3R2CHMFh7QanuRv232qVU9QVdhC_hzmxjfPlKp4jcUY/s640/20140815_185409+%25282%2529.jpg" width="587" /></a></div>
<div class="MsoNormal" style="margin-left: 1.5pt;">
<br /></div>
<div class="MsoNormal" style="margin-left: 1.5pt;">
<br /></div>
<div class="MsoNormal" style="margin-left: 1.5pt;">
The image of the Stormcast Lord
shows the use of the glazes to add colour and then the use white to add the
reflection points and final highlights.</div>
